- W1504171358 abstract "Three cases of opportunistic cutaneous aspergillosis caused by Aspergillus chevalieri are described. The lesions were erythematous and hyperkeratotic with vesicopapular eruptions and scaling. Histopathology revealed granulomatous reaction showing polymorphonuclear leucocytes around fungal hyphae, which were broad, septate, branched and aggregated in the epidermal area. Oxiconazole and amorolfine, with a minimum inhibitory concentration of 10 μg ml-1, were the most active drugs against A. chevalieri ‘in vitro’. A. chevalieri is, for the first time, documented as opportunistic pathogen of man. Zusammenfassung. Es werden drei Fälle opportunistischer, kutaner Aspergillosen beschrieben, verursacht durch Aspergillus chevalieri. Die Läsionen hatten erythematösen Charakter, waren hyperkeratotisch mit vesikopapulären Eruptionen und Schuppung. Histopathologisch zeigte sich eine granulomatöse Reaktion mit polymorphonukleären Granulozyten in der Nachbarschaft von Pilzhyphen, die großlumig, septiert, verzweigt und aggregiert im epidermalen Bereich lokalisiert waren. Oxiconazol und Amorolfin mit MHKs von 10 μg ml-1 in vitro erwiesen sich als die gegen A. chevalieri wirksamsten Antimykotika. Somit wird A. chevalieri zum ersten Mal als opportunistischer Erreger beim Menschen dokumentiert." @default.
